REED: Joan Marie (Barber) of Goderich and formerly of Sault Ste Marie, Milton and Elora

It is with great sadness that we share that Joan Marie Reed (Barber) of Goderich formerly of Sault Ste Marie, Milton and Elora Ontario, passed away after a quick and unexpected battle with Cancer.  She passed away peacefully on November 10, 2023 at Huron Hospice with family by her side at the young age of 61.

To know Joan was to know what it is to be loved.  Family was the most important thing to her and she would do anything for those around her near and far.  Joan was a creative spirit who loved the outdoors and had just completed a 300 km bike trip with her husband Steve in Nova Scotia this past September.  Joan often said her happy place was on a lake only accessible by canoe in the back country of Algonquin Park.

Joan was the loved wife of Stephen Reed for 43 years.  Cherished mother of Lindsey Peacocke (Sean) and Matthew Reed (Andrea).  And beloved Nana to Cole and Brynn Peacocke.  Joan was a dear daughter to Roma and the late George Barber.

She will be deeply missed by her sisters Linda Matchim (Carl), Helen Barber (Brian) and late brother Robert (Lenora).  As well as Ken and Norma Reed, Brian Reed (Debbie), Dale Reed (Niccette), Bonnie Jalak (Steve) and many dear nieces and nephews and friends.

To carry on Joan’s passion for caring for others, in lieu of flowers, a donation in Joan’s name to the Huron Hospice would be appreciated by her family. Details can be found at www.huronhospice.ca/donate.

A Celebration of Life will be held for close family in Algonquin Park as well as Sault Ste Marie, ON.  The family will notify loved ones regarding the details.

Our Service Coverage Area

Service AreaWe are always willing to go where called upon but this image shows a visual of the communities that our included in our initial transportation fee. We offer a 40km radius from any of our 5 locations (Arva (London), Exeter, Lucan, Seaforth, and Zurich). Any mileage beyond the included 40km will be charged a rate of $2.50/km (one way travel only).

Potential Additional Transportation Fees

$150 - If transport requires more than one person, additional fee charged per person required
$150 - If transport occurs outside Mon-Fri, 9-5 business hours
